We are looking for a CRM Brand Specialist to join our Digital team here at Harrods. This new position in the team and will be essential in unlocking and supporting major growth potential with our Partnerships and CRM divisions.

About the Role

The CRM Brand Specialist will lead the roadmap to help build the new CRM landscape for our
brand partners and provide invaluable support in aligning the strategies of both teams to achieve maximum commercial and marketing success.

You will also;

  • Ensure campaigns are delivered on time and work with your manager to lead productive consultation brief meetings with our brands and partners to support their initiatives in-line with our CRM objectives
  • Intercept and interrogate client briefs to responding with bespoke solutions, innovating with the CRM team to deliver best in class media solutions across the CRM portfolio.
  • Ensuring plans are  delivered on time and reported on and commercial targets are top of mind
  • Work across both our BAU and Lifecycle/Retention strategies across all channels (Email, SMS, Push and Direct Mail).

About You

The ideal candidate will have previous experience working with brands and partnerships, supporting brand Partner marketing strategies and objectives as well as operating with commercial insight and acumen in executing brand partnerships.

 It is important that you have a good understanding of ESPs and Google Analytics and a good understand of the importance of reporting on KPIs across all channels

You will also have the following;

  • Experience in project managing/highly organised to manage a busy calendar
  • Excellent communication and organisation skills to confidently lead discussions with internal and external stakeholders
  • Understand email best practises and GDPR - be that expert within the team
  • Experience in developing and maintaining a wide network of relationships to unlock resource and expertise to achieve role objectives
